Instructions
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). In a mixing bowl, combine almond flour, melted coconut oil, maple syrup, and sea salt. Mix well until a dough forms.
Press the dough evenly into the bottom of the prepared baking pan.
Bake the crust for 15 minutes, or until lightly golden.
While the crust is baking, prepare the filling. In a separate bowl, combine blackberries, applesauce, chia seeds, lemon juice, and vanilla extract.
Mix well and let sit for 10 minutes to allow the chia seeds to thicken the mixture.
Pour the blackberry filling over the pre-baked crust.
Return to the oven and bake for another 20 minutes, or until the filling is set and bubbly.
Let the blackberry slice cool completely before cutting into squares. Refrigerate for at least 2 hours for best results.
Notes
Store leftovers in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
